Thank you Beth Ann & Welcome Stacey

For 33 years, Beth Ann Schultz has been a dedicated member of our team, providing exceptional care to our tenants, their families, and our team members at Wellhaven Senior Living.
“It has been my pleasure being a part of our tenant’s life,” said Beth Ann. “I have truly enjoyed watching tenants get comfortable with Wellhaven as their new home then caring for them as their needs changed. I will miss everyone here.”
In April, Beth Ann will transition her position and train Stacey Sayler as the new Senior Living Director at Wellhaven. Stacey began her nursing career as a Licensed Practical Nurse at The Lutheran Home’s skilled nursing facility in River Falls. Her work history includes such various settings as a clinic, long-term care, assisted living, and memory care.

Stacey earned her practical nursing diploma from Minnesota State College, Southeast Technical. She continued her education to earn a bachelor’s degree from the University of Wisconsin, River Falls in business administration with an emphasis on management and a minor in international studies.
